## Auth for the Checkout Load Tests

Before you approve changes to the Tillburrow load harness, a quick note on auth: the synthetic checkout flow hits the staging payment stub, which requires a service credential — anonymous runs get rate-limited to uselessness after about 50 requests. The harness reads the credential from its config file at startup; no env vars needed. For running the suite against staging, the credential is below.

gateway credential: kto3_qfe

Hey Priya — handing off the Tollbridge kiosk release. The watchdog now restarts the shell within five seconds instead of rebooting the whole unit; please eyeball the timer logic in the review. Everything else is cosmetic. The build is staged and ready to sign with the key below.

release key, hagug-yaguf: bky13_NnhXrmFGhCRtW

Onboarding note for the facilities desk at Quillbridge Tower. The basement archive (room B-04) stores legal deeds, vendor contracts, and retired equipment logs. Access is restricted: confirm the requester appears on the archive access roster before escorting them down. Use stairwell C, as the goods lift does not stop at basement level after 18:00. The room must never be propped open, and the ledger by the door must be signed on every visit. The keypad accepts the current door-pass code, shown below.

door code, yagap-bahof: bdg-O-05

### Ticket MX-2211 — Vault locked, GC pause metrics unavailable

Hey plugin folks — the Quillmarsh secrets vault sealed itself overnight, so the matching service's GC-pause dashboards (which pull creds from it) are blank. Your plugins may see stale pause data until we unseal. One of us needs to enter the vault recovery passphrase, recorded below for the on-call unsealer.

unlock words, yawig-kagef: gordor-holvan-ulaael-pramir-ulaiel-tamdor